Jigging Techniques
Jigging represents a fundamental technique in ice fishing, and proficient virtual anglers devote considerable time to mastering its nuances. The efficacy of jigging is partly influenced by the style in which the lure is moved. Subtle, understated jigs may entice wary fish, while rapid, assertive movements may provoke a reaction from more aggressive species. Most games accurately model the water resistance and resulting motion of the lure, requiring players to adapt their technique to the prevailing conditions. Successful jigging necessitates a keen awareness of line tension and a responsive reaction speed to detect subtle bites.
Understanding Fish Behavior
Effective ice fishing, both real and virtual, heavily relies on understanding fish behavior. Different species have varying preferences regarding their habitat, feeding habits, and reaction to stimulation. Some fish favor deeper waters near structure, while others prefer shallows with ample vegetation. In many ice fishing games, developers carefully model these patterns, creating a dynamic ecosystem where fish behavior responds to the time of day, weather conditions, and the player’s actions. Learning to interpret these cues and adjust your approach accordingly is key to consistently landing fish.
The Role of Technology
Beyond the core gameplay, modern ice fishing games often incorporate advanced technologies to enhance the experience. Sonar systems allow players to scan the underwater environment, identifying fish schools and potential hotspots. GPS navigation aids in locating favorite fishing spots and tracking your progress. The integration of customizable dashboards and data analytics provides real-time insights into your fishing performance, enabling you to optimize your strategy. These technological tools not only add to the realism but also provide a valuable learning experience for aspiring ice anglers.
